Bombay Post is an Indian restaurant located in Unsworth Heights, Albany, Auckland. Chef Chait brings over 20 years of experience in both Indian and European cuisine to the menu, featuring a fusion of cultures with authentic curries and pizza options. Some must-try specialties include garlic prawns, fish Malabari, Bunny Chow, and Goat curry. Bombay Post caters to individuals or large gatherings alike with dine-in, takeaway or delivery services available. Accepting cash, eftpos and credit cards as payment options.
